Our Approach

Casey House engages compassion to deliver holistic health care. We respect personal autonomy and provide care within the context of people’s lives, choices, and circumstances. Built on a history of activism, Casey House acknowledges that systemic inequities have a profound effect on people’s lives and believes that everyone deserves judgment-free care.

Our Origins

Opened in 1988 by a group of intrepid volunteers led by June Callwood, Casey House has a rich history of compassionate care and social justice.
